Pachuca to Acatlán - Language, Currency, Distance, How to Reach, Expenses, Best time to go, What to Eat, Where to Go, FAQ

Language

The official language of both Pachuca and Acatlán is Spanish.

Currency

The currency used in both Pachuca and Acatlán is the Mexican Peso (MXN).

Distance

The distance between Pachuca and Acatlán is approximately 230 kilometers (143 miles).

How to Reach

The best way to travel from Pachuca to Acatlán is by bus. There are several bus companies that offer direct bus services between the two cities.

Expenses

The cost of a bus ticket from Pachuca to Acatlán ranges from 200 to 300 Mexican Pesos (10 to 15 USD).

Best time to go

The best time to visit Acatlán is during the dry season, which runs from October to May.

What to Eat

Some of the traditional dishes that you can try in Acatlán include mole poblano, cemitas, and chalupas.

Where to Go

Some of the popular tourist attractions in Acatlán include the Church of San Juan Bautista, the Plaza de Armas, and the Museo de la Ciudad.

FAQ

Here are some of the frequently asked questions about traveling from Pachuca to Acatlán:

  • How long does it take to travel from Pachuca to Acatlán?
  • The travel time by bus is approximately 4-5 hours.

  • Are there any direct flights from Pachuca to Acatlán?
  • No, there are no direct flights from Pachuca to Acatlán.
